Itinerary and Experience
Starting at the Arctic Adventure base camp in Skaftafell, participants embark on a scenic 20-minute bus ride to Falljökull, setting the stage for an unforgettable guided hiking tour on Vatnajökull Glacier.
Upon arrival, a certified guide leads the group on a 5-hour trek, showcasing the stunning ice fall and dramatic glacier landscapes. Participants enjoy a safety briefing and receive crampons for secure footing on the icy terrain.
As they hike, they encounter mesmerizing ice sculptures and breathtaking views that create lasting memories. The tour emphasizes engagement, with the guide sharing insights about the glacier’s formation and ecology.

Inclusions and Requirements
Included in the Skaftafell Glacier Tour are all necessary gear, a certified tour guide, and provisions for food and drinks, ensuring a well-rounded and enjoyable adventure.
Participants must be at least 14 years old, with a minimum shoe size of 35 EU and a maximum of 50 EU. This tour isn’t suitable for children under 14 due to safety considerations.
To make the most of the experience, guests should wear warm outdoor clothing, waterproof jackets and pants, gloves, and sturdy hiking shoes—rentals are available if needed.
It’s also recommended to bring a water bottle and snacks for the journey. This preparation helps everyone enjoy the breathtaking glacier landscapes safely and comfortably.
Meeting Point Details
Meeting at the Arctic Adventures booking hut in Skaftafell National Park, you will find a gray house with a turf roof, making it easy to locate before embarking on their glacier exploration.
The meeting point is well-marked and serves as the starting hub for the adventure. Guests should arrive at least 15 minutes early to check in and prepare for the tour. It’s advisable to check the specific starting times in advance, as availability may vary.
Once everyone is gathered, the certified guide will provide a safety briefing and gear fitting, ensuring everyone is equipped and ready for the stunning landscapes ahead.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Is the Best Time of Year for the Tour?
The best time for glacier tours is typically late spring to early fall, when weather’s milder and trails are more accessible. This period offers stunning views and a safe hiking experience on the ice.
Are There Any Age Restrictions for Participants?
There are age restrictions for participants. Individuals must be at least 14 years old to join, ensuring safety and enjoyment. Plus, shoe size requirements range between 35 EU and 50 EU for all participants.
Can I Bring My Camera on the Glacier?
Yes, participants can bring their cameras on the glacier. They’ll capture stunning views and unique ice formations. However, they should ensure their gear is secure and manageable during the guided hiking tour.
Is Transportation Provided From Reykjavik to the Tour Starting Point?
Transportation from Reykjavik to the tour starting point isn’t included. Participants need to arrange their own travel to the Arctic Adventures booking hut in Skaftafell National Park before joining the glacier explorer tour.
What Happens in Case of Bad Weather?
In case of bad weather, the tour operator assesses conditions and prioritizes safety. They may reschedule or cancel the tour, offering full refunds if necessary, ensuring participants stay informed and have options available.
